Cursed Child is now officially back at the Princess Theatre in Australia, where audiences were on-hand to give a moving gesture of thanks to the cast and crew, using magically lit-up wands. Grab a tissue and take a look at how the magical scene unfolded.

After all this time? Always. Yes, the Cursed Child cast and crew in Australia have now returned to their rightful home, after being forced to pause production on their show for nearly 11 months throughout the Covid pandemic. But now – they are very much back - with the magic now properly reinstated at the Princess Theatre. The reunion was deeply poignant for the cast and crew – as you’ll see below - and, of course, the audience.

In these emotional videos, you can see how the audience welcomed home the Cursed Child performers in style, as they were all given their own special wands to light up the auditorium and properly commemorate their return to the stage. After a rapturous applause, the cast looked visibly touched as they gave a special speech to the spectators.

Gareth Reeves, who plays Harry Potter in this production, summed up the scene perfectly, telling the audience, “You made it!” looking notably heart-warmed in the moment. And, of course, Gareth delivered the tender speech about the triumphant return with Paula Arundell (Hermione) and Michael Whalley (Ron) by his side. As Ron and Hermione always should be.

We can also see footage of the thorough health and safety efforts that the gallant staff at the Princess Theatre have implemented to make the venue extra-safe for theatre goers during the pandemic.

As you can see, a lot of hard work has gone into Cursed Child’s momentous comeback at the Princess Theatre, with the magic now back to cast a spell on Australian audiences.

HPCC-australia-harry-potter-selfie

“It means everything, it’s my second home, it’s my church, it’s everything,” said Gareth Reeves. “It’s my family. It’s the place where I belong. It’s where I fulfil my purpose in life, so, you know, it’s pretty big!”
